Q

usability and rule complexity (Nielson, 2016) (4)

A

level 0 - few steps are required and no sub-goal has to be generated
level 1 - only simple forms of reasoning, such as assigning items to categories, no need to contrast or integrate information
level 2 - may require evaluating relevance and discarding distractors. some integration and inferential reasoning may be needed
level 3 - may require evaluating relevance and reliability of information in order to discard distractors. integration and inferential reasoning may be needed to a large extent

Q

usability and colour blindness (4)

A
  • avoid problematic colour combinations
  • use high contrast and modulate brightness, saturation and hue
  • use thicker lines
  • use both colours and symbols

Q

fine motor skills in usability

A
  • don’t have short time-out windows
  • provide shortcuts
  • design for keyboard or speech-only use
  • give content and form fields space
  • make large clickable actions
